This has the romance which every Schoolboy craved! This Flintlock Pistol dates to 1800 to 1820 and originates in the Ottoman Empire, which today we refer to as Turkey. However at that time the Empire embraced much of Eastern Europe, the Middle East and spread across Northern Africa. This pistol has a wood stock which is heavily carved with decorated brass mounts, the intricate brass side plate on the left side
